: Civil 3D is entirely style-driven. Spend time learning how a "Surface Style" controls visibility before trying to draw complex designs.
The "Civil 3D" workspace is different from standard AutoCAD. Your manual should explain the (Prospector, Settings, Survey, and Toolbox tabs), which is the heart of every project. 2. Points and Surfaces You cannot build a project without a site. Learn how to: Import COGO points. Create a TIN (Triangulated Irregular Network) surface. Edit contours and boundaries. 3.
